Abstract
A method of accessing a disc-shaped recording medium including the steps of (a) recording defect information on the disc-shaped recording medium including a first logical address data of defective sectors, the first logical address data being a serial logical address data assigned to all sectors including both effective and defective sectors, (b) recording on a predetermined physical location of the disc-shaped recording medium disc information containing recorded physical position information of the defect information which represents a physical data structure, (c) reading out the disc information from the disc-shaped recording medium, (d) reading out the defect information using the physical recorded position information contained in the disc information read out at step (c), (e) generating a first table using the defect information which is used to convert the first logical address data into a second logical address data, the second logical address data being an address data assigned only to the effective sectors, (f) generating a second table using the disc information read out at step (c) which is used to convert the second logical address data into a physical address data of the disc-shaped recording medium, (g) using the first table to convert the first logical address data to be accessed into the second logical address data, (h) using the second table to convert the second logical address data into the physical address data and (i) accessing the disc-shaped recording medium using the physical address data generated at step (h).
